Greenskins using currency?
So after watching the campaign walkthrough for the Greenskins, and also with the understanding that the game is still in heavy development, and subject to change, let me put this out, mainly directed to the developers.

I noticed that the Greenskins seem to be using gold as a currency. Which is odd, to say the least.

With a unique tech tree, and other unique mechanics tied to each faction, why not go all the way and have a go at the economics of the game for each faction?

Empire/Dwarfs - Use gold.

Chaos/Greenskins - Use labour.

Want to build a Big Boyz barracks? Well, it makes more sense for the Greenskins to use labour as a currency which is a catch-all term for slaves/goblin workers, without the need to upset anyone who may find such a term offensive.

I noticed on the video that at one point, it listed Campaign Effects: Sacking income +5. Well, why not turn that on its head for the Greenskins, and instead have +5 labour.

I can't see this being a big thing to work into the game. Even if it was a name change on the interface, I'd be happy enough.

I'd just look at it as an abstraction; it's not representing actual currency, but a wide variety of available resources - wood, metal, labour, gobbo slaves, teef, etc. That's how I always see the resource system in any strategy game, really. Dawn of War 1 was the only one that I felt was less abstracted than the others; armies were requisitioning troops and equipment, not buying them.

I play a lot of tabletop RPGs - the mechanics in those are pretty heavily abstracted. The 40k ones (all but the 1st edition of Dark Heresy, at least) all use a heavily-abstracted system in place of real currency; Rogue Trader, for example, just has you make a test against the crew's Profit Factor when buying something (since Rogue Traders are so stupidly-wealthy that they need an entire army of accountants to keep track of it all).
